iA Web Trends Map 2007 2.0

I’ve long been a fan of quasi geographic visualisation and after stumbling across this beautiful rendering of 200 popular sites on the net by Information Architects, a “Strategic Design Agency” in Japan, I felt the need to share and enjoy!

If you’re feeling a sense of déjà vu when looking at the map then that’s because it’s closely based on the Tokyo metro map – mind boggling in itself. Each line has been given a theme (e.g. Technology, News…) and some vague logic has been applied to the placement of each site as well as a “weather” forecast for future prospects. For those who know Tokyo you might spot a few in-jokes here also!

No matter what you make of the utility of the map it’s pretty cool :)
